Kansas DOT solicits submissions for rail improvement program


advertisement

The Kansas Department of Transportation (KDOT) is soliciting project submissions for the state’s Rail Service Improvement Program.

The financial program aims to assist short lines in the rehabilitation of tracks and components, bridges, sidings, yards, shops and buildings.

An estimated $10 million in program funding is available for selected projects that enhance safety and promote economic efficiency and sustainability in the state’s rail network, KDOT officials said in a press release. The deadline for submissions is Sept. 1 and the awarded projects will be announced in spring 2024.

Regionals, short lines or any owner or lessee of industry track located on or adjacent to a Class II or Class III railroad in the state are eligible to apply for the grants.

Applicants are required to provide a 30% match of a project’s total cost. There are no minimum or maximum project awards, KDOT officials said.
